Do you have a child in your life that you want to help pay for their college tuition?

Tuition costs can range anywhere from $10k-$40k depending on if you attend a public or private college. Even on the lower end of the scale, that’s a lot of money to save and as someone who doesn’t have any kids but has a niece, I wanted to pick the brain of Marc Russell, the founder of BetterWallet to see if there’s any way I could help contribute to her college savings fund. Listen to today’s episode to get the details on contributing to a 529 plan as a non-parent, taxes, and everything in-between.
